タグ

2022年12月11日のブックマーク (5件)

  • Spring Modulith でモジュラモノリスなアプリの構造を検証してみた - Taste of Tech Topics

    アクロクエスト アドベントカレンダー 12月9日 の記事です。 普段は Java, Python でバックエンドの開発をしている大塚優斗です😃 最近は Spring フレームワークのメジャーアップデートなどで盛り上がっていますね! 10月にこんな記事を見かけて、Spring Modulith がとても気になっていたので、手元で試したことを書いていきます✍️ Spring Modulith とは Spring Modulith でできること 0. Spring Modulith でのパッケージの扱いについて 1. モジュール構造の検証 循環参照の検知 別モジュールへのアクセス違反の検知 2. モジュールに閉じた結合テスト 単一のアプリケーションモジュールで結合テストができること Bootstrap モードによって、結合テスト時に他モジュールの Bean 生成ができること 3. イベントによ

    Spring Modulith でモジュラモノリスなアプリの構造を検証してみた - Taste of Tech Topics
    NetPenguin
    NetPenguin 2022/12/11
    もしかして、パッケージ間やクラスの細かな参照可否をプロジェクトの制約として定義して、ビルド時に検証してくれる? ずっと欲しかったやつやーっ!! と思ったら、細かく制約を定義できるわけではなさそう?
  • ソフトウェアテストの実行を効率化するPredictive Test Selectionの衝撃 - Qiita

    12月10日の2022ソフトウェアテストアドベントカレンダーです。 Launchable社でエンジニアとして働いているcvuskと申します。機械学習界隈では機械学習を実用化するためのシステム開発のを書いてたります。もし良かったら読んでみてください。 『機械学習システムデザインパターン』 『機械学習システム構築実践ガイド』 ブログでは機械学習を用いてテスト実行を効率化する手法として、Predictive Test Selectionについて説明します。テスト実行時間やコストで課題を抱えているエンジニアに役に立つと幸いです。 昨今の開発におけるテスト事情 2002年に『テスト駆動開発』が世に出て、ソフトウェア開発でテストを書くことが常識になって早20年が経っています。その間にクラウドの登場やDevOpsの普及により、テストをCI/CDパイプラインで自動実行し、コードとプロダクト品質を維持す

    ソフトウェアテストの実行を効率化するPredictive Test Selectionの衝撃 - Qiita
    NetPenguin
    NetPenguin 2022/12/11
    試してみたい。 Jenkins+Gradle(Kotlin)の場合、CLIでファイルの変更セットを送って、CLIでテスト結果をおくれば良さそう?
  • たのしいコーディングのための「CUPID」特性 - iki-iki

    当初はちょっとしたSOLID批判のつもりが、「藪を突ついて蛇を出して」しまったのですが、物事はそこから具体的で目に見えるものへと発展しました。仮に、近頃はSOLID原則が役に立たなくなっているのだとしたら、何に置き換えればよいのでしょう? あらゆるソフトウェアに通用する原則はあるのでしょうか? そもそも「原則」とは何を意味するのでしょう? 私は「仕事がたのしくなるソフトウェアならではの特性や性質がある」ということを確信しています。コードでそのような質が高まれば高まるほど、仕事もどんどんたのしくなります。しかし、何事もトレードオフですから、自分の置かれている状況をつねに考慮する必要があります。 そうした特性はたくさん存在しており、互いに重なりや関連がありますし、説明の仕方もさまざまです。ここでは私がコードで気にかけている要素を強く支えていると思える5つを選びました。選ぶ数はこれぐらいが丁度良

    たのしいコーディングのための「CUPID」特性 - iki-iki
  • はてな運営の対応が「!?」だった件について

    これは自分のはてなブログの「問い合わせ」から、はてな運営に向けてメールしたやり取りの、全文コピー晒し文である。 はてな運営との話し合いが噛み合わないので「どーゆーこっちゃ!」の疑念を世間に問いたい。 自分⇔はてな運営、5通ずつ計10通のメール なお増田として書くのは初めてなので設定云々が解らず、こーゆーフォーマットで書いておく。 では、メール開始 ʕ•̫͡•ʕ•̫͡•ʔ•̫͡•ʔ•̫͡•ʕ•̫͡•ʔ•̫͡•ʕ•̫͡•ʕ•̫͡•ʔ•̫͡•ʔ•̫͡•ʕ•̫͡•ʔ•̫͡•ʕ•̫͡•ʕ•̫͡•ʔ•̫͡•ʔ•̫͡•ʕ•̫͡•ʔ•̫͡•ʕ•̫͡• はてなブログではなく、はてなブックマークの方についてのメールを送信します。 最近、自分のコメントにスターが幾つか付いても人気コメに登場しなくなりました。 以前はスター100個越え、人気コメで1位だった事もありました。 しかし最近は、文字数が少ない時も目一杯ま

    はてな運営の対応が「!?」だった件について
    NetPenguin
    NetPenguin 2022/12/11
    はてなの運営、ちゃんとしてんのな。 あと、運営のひとはこの質問者に限定された話はしていなくて、だけど質問者は自分だけが特別に規制されている話をしていて、噛み合っていない感じもある。
  • 男性向け同人とかに検索避け文化とかがない理由が今更ながら分かった

    ぼっちざロックの一件、割と周りでも話題になったんで女性と男性どっちにも雑談ついでにヒアリングして分かったことがある。 男性、嫌いな物に対する耐性がめちゃくちゃ高い。 びっくりするぐらい高い。 割と腐とか夢とかこのへん関係なく女性ってとにかく自分の嫌いな表現(これは絵柄とかシチュ、○○との絡みとか多岐に渡る)を一瞬だって目に入れたくない!見たくもない!って人が割と多い。 私もまあ騒ぐほどじゃないけども一回見ちゃうと半日引きずってテンション下がるぐらいの地雷は多少ある。 でも男性ってこの人繊細だなあって女から見ても思う人でも「目に入る事」に関しては許容する空気がある。 嫌いだけど別に見たっていいじゃん、邪魔ならそいつを「見てから」ブロックかミュートすりゃいいって人しかいない。 それが大勢、とかではなくそういう人しかいない。 書き手読み手どっちもそんな感じ。 なんていうか、「見たくない権利」とい

    男性向け同人とかに検索避け文化とかがない理由が今更ながら分かった
    NetPenguin
    NetPenguin 2022/12/11
    進化の過程で生き残るための戦略が違うのかも。